You can chant the full mantra formally, seated at your altar, and then keep Hari (or Hari Bol) going ALL DAY (and night). You'll see :) 'Hari' means 'the remover of illusion' and it is said that when one repeats It, sins, karmas , pain and suffering are removed. Hari or Hare is also known as the energy of God, the Love, the Bliss (Ananda). Do not live an existence limited by seeming lack, a narrow stinted existence, but allow Me to fulfill My purpose in creating you, a unit of Myself." - Eva Bell Werber, Voice of the Master "And the sound of "Hare Krsna, Haribol," that become . .. according . . there are two slogans. One Hare Krsna, Hare Krsna, and another, short, is Haribol, Haribol. You can practice also that. Haribol. Devotee: Haribol. Prabhupada: Yes. Haribol. That is a shortcut of Hare Krsna. Yes. Haribol. Haribol means "the sound of Hari, or the Lord." Haribol. So whenever there was some greeting, Caitanya Mahaprabhu used to answer, raising His hand, "Haribol." - Srila Prabhupada
